Given that Lombardi just dealt for Smyth and a 6.25 cap hit, it seems unlikely that he would make a deal for another player.

But after Lombardi admitted to Hammond the other day that he was indeed looking to acquire the gritty winger, I got word from a very well placed source that has told me that the Kings are still trying to acquire him.

Cap hit wise Hartnell is at 4.2 but salary wise, his next 4 years are intriguing: 4.2, 4.2, 3.7 and 3.2. For a 27 year old, that's just too delicious to pass up.

Lombardi isn't going to get anywhere near those kind of numbers trying to re-sign Frolov.

And even though I've been insisting Jack Johnson is staying put, his name keeps coming up. I can't even imagine how sick Philadelphia fans would be at the thought of Pronger, Johnson, Timonen and Coburn - Talk about two lines that can shut down Crosby and Ovechkin!

Philadelphia needs cap space and either Hartnell or Gagne or less likely, Briere will be moves.

As a Kings fan, I hope Scotty waives his no trade clause.
